Which plant hormone is involved in the formation of adventitious roots from stem cuttings?

Gibberellin
Cytokinin
Auxin
Abscisic acid
3

Auxins, such as IAA and IBA, promote the formation of adventitious roots in stem cuttings.

Which plant growth regulator is responsible for bolting in rosette plants like cabbage?

Ethylene
Gibberellin
Auxin
Abscisic acid
2

Gibberellins promote bolting (rapid internode elongation) in rosette plants like cabbage and beet.

Which plant growth regulator is responsible for delaying senescence and promoting nutrient mobilization?

Gibberellin
Cytokinin
Auxin
Abscisic acid
2

Cytokinins delay leaf senescence (anti-aging hormone) and promote nutrient mobilization.

Which of the following statements about plant growth regulators is correct?

Ethylene promotes root elongation.
Auxin inhibits apical dominance.
Cytokinin delays leaf senescence.
Gibberellins inhibit seed germination.
3

Cytokinins delay leaf senescence (anti-aging hormone). Auxin promotes apical dominance, and gibberellins promote, not inhibit, seed germination.

Select the correct statement about seed germination:

Gibberellins promote the production of alpha-amylase.
Abscisic acid breaks seed dormancy.
Ethylene inhibits seed germination.
Auxins promote seed germination directly.
1

Gibberellins stimulate alpha-amylase production, which breaks down starch into sugars during seed germination. Abscisic acid induces, not breaks, dormancy.

Which plant growth regulator is commonly used in the brewing industry to accelerate malting?

Cytokinin
Gibberellin
Auxin
Ethylene
2

Gibberellin (GA3) is used in the brewing industry to speed up the malting process by promoting enzyme production.
